Senior Research Engineer, Olmo + Molmo
Listed on 2026-06-15
-
Software Development
Machine Learning/ ML Engineer, AI Engineer (Applied/Software), Software Engineer, Python
Persons in these roles are expected to work from our offices in Seattle. On-site requirements vary based on position and team. If you have questions about on-site work arrangements for this role, please ask your recruiter. Our base salary range is $146,880 - $220,320, and in addition we have generous bonus plans to provide a competitive compensation package.
Who You Are:
To thrive as a Research Engineer at Ai2, you'll bring a blend of deep technical expertise and a collaborative, self-directed mindset. You have extensive experience with deep learning and/or foundation models — whether through a PhD in ML or equivalent hands‑on industry work. You're a curious, agile engineer who can generate ideas, design experiments, and implement them in Python against real AI systems.
You communicate research insights clearly to technical stakeholders, and you're energized by working with strong contributors toward shared, ambitious goals.
As a Research Engineer on the team, you'll be a core member responsible for training Ai2's flagship open models (e.g. Olmo, Molmo, and beyond). From system design to experiment release, you'll own end-to-end delivery while collaborating closely with research and engineering colleagues to push the boundaries of open model research.
Key Responsibilities:- Building and optimizing infrastructure for LLM, multimodal, and agentic research — including training/inference pipelines, dataset curation, and large‑scale preprocessing
- Designing, training, and evaluating multimodal models (vision + language) and agentic workflows, including tool use, planning, and long-horizon tasks
- Scoping and leading research projects, prioritizing experiments for highest impact
- Bringing strong software engineering practices to a research environment and bridging cutting‑edge work to production‑quality products
- Contributing to and supporting the open-source community through model releases, datasets, public APIs, and technical reports
- 4+ years of ML infrastructure experience — data preprocessing, model training, evaluation, inference, and deployment
- Experience with end-to-end model development — dataset construction, training, fine-tuning, evaluation, profiling, and monitoring
- Familiarity with modern model architectures — including LLMs (MoEs, long-context models), vision‑language models (e.g., Molmo, LLaVA), and experience training and evaluating both
- Agentic systems knowledge — tools, memory, and long-running workflows
- Strong software engineering fundamentals — performant, scalable systems and confident debugging
- Proficiency in Python and a major ML framework (PyTorch, JAX, or Tensor Flow), with the flexibility to pick up new tools as needed
- Familiarity with cloud and containerization (e.g., GCP, AWS, Docker)
- Strong communication and collaboration skills — we're a small, close-knit team and work best when everyone's pulling in the same direction
- BS or MSc in Computer Science, Statistics, Engineering, Applied Mathematics, or a related quantitative field (or equivalent experience)
- A minimum of 2 years of software development experience. (or equivalent experience)
The physical demands described here are representative of those that must be met by a team member to successfully perform the essential functions of this position. Reasonable accommodations may be made to enable individuals with disabilities to perform the functions.
- Must be able to remain in a stationary position for long periods of time.
- The ability to communicate information and ideas so others will understand. Must be able to exchange accurate information in these situations.
- The ability to observe details at close range.
Ai2 is proud to be an Equal Opportunity employer. We do not discriminate based upon race, religion, color, national origin, sex (including pregnancy, childbirth, or related medical conditions), sexual orientation, gender, gender identity, gender expression, transgender status, sexual stereotypes, age, status as a protected veteran, status as an individual with a disability, or other applicable legally protected characteristics.…
(If this job is in fact in your jurisdiction, then you may be using a Proxy or VPN to access this site, and to progress further, you should change your connectivity to another mobile device or PC).